LINUX.ORG.RU

time для windows


0

0

Хочется измерить быстродействие программы под различными ОС,
для *nix это просто: time имя_программы аргументы,
есть ли аналогичный механизм для windows?
может быть где-то существует time.exe портированный?

ЗЫ

гуглил ничего не нашел.

Не хотелось бы встраивать код измерения времени в программу.

anonymous

Ответ на: комментарий от alexru

time.exe меняет текущее время, по крайней мере в w2k так.

anonymous
()
Ответ на: комментарий от anonymous

скажи спасибо модераторам :) От моего имени :) Желательно в обсуждении сайта, а то они быстро хвост поджимают и в кусты драпают, как по делу спросишь :)

vilfred ☆☆
()

такая программа пишется самим за 5 минут. примерно так

1. t_begin = Текущее время 2. Выполняем нужную программу, ждем пока она закончится 3. t_end = Текущее время 4. t_execution (время выполнения) = t_end - t_begin

GameMagister
()
Ответ на: комментарий от GameMagister

за пять минут?
а показать какой отрезок времени использовался пользователем, какой системой
и сколько это всего заняло?

anonymous
()
Ответ на: комментарий от kosmonavt

можно еще взять tcl,
puts [ time {exec myprogram} 1000 ]
сие значит 1000 раз запустить программу и вывести статистику..

вообще в плане тестирования tcl лучше таки изучить,
чтобы потом спокойно пользоваться tcl_test и DejaGNU


anonymous
()

посмотрите в cygwin, там должен бытb time.exe

Vinick ★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.